I have installed the turning ball replacement system and rearranged the pulley system on my 2001 C250wb-works great. Four questions--1. How tall should the pvc pipe be? 2. how is the pvc held in place? 3. leakage concern at the reduced length rubber hose an the reduced pvc connection? 4.Could I reduce the pvc to go inside the hose? Help!!!
If the system on the 250 is like the 25, the PVC pipe is there to protect the rubber hose. The rubber hose is there to raise the thru-hull opening to be above the waterline. Not a good idea to reduce the hose length, and the PVC pipe should be as tall or slightly taller than the hose once installed. Why can't you reuse the original PVC pipe?
